| Varianta 33 / Subiectul 3 / Problema 4 | 
| #include<fstream.h>
ifstream f("numere.in");
void main()
{ int x=0,y,z=9999,n,i;
  long k;
  f>>n;
  for(i=1;i<=n*n;i++)
    { f>>k;
      if(k<=999)
	{ if(k>x) { y=x;
		   x=k;
		 }
	 else if(k>y) y=k;
	}
      else if(k>=1000 && k<=9999)
	     if(k<z) z=k;
     }
  if(x-y<z-x) cout<<x<<" "<<y;
  else cout<<x<<" "<<z;
} |